Global Autonomous Networks Hyperloop Market size was valued at USD 3.37 Billion in 2024 and is poised to grow from USD 4.73 Billion in 2025 to USD 71.43 Bill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 40.4% during the forecast period (2026-2033).

Global Autonomous Networks Hyperloop are gaining traction due to their numerous advantages over conventional transportation systems. Key benefits include unparalleled speed and efficiency, enhanced safety, and reduced travel times, leading to increased capacity and decreased congestion. Hyperloop technology enables swift travel, surpassing traditional modes while prioritizing energy efficiency and sustainability with lower energy consumption, utilizing electric propulsion systems powered by various renewable sources. Additionally, this autonomous network continuously monitors tracks and trains, ensuring safety by preemptively addressing potential issues before they escalate. As this innovative transport solution develops, it promises significant reductions in travel times and alleviates urban traffic congestion, positioning itself as a pivotal change in global transportation dynamics.

Driver of the Global Autonomous Networks Hyperloop Market

As urban areas around the world become increasingly populated, there is a pressing need for transportation systems to enhance their efficiency and sustainability in order to accommodate rising demand. Autonomous Hyperloop networks present an innovative solution, enabling rapid travel at speeds that far exceed traditional transportation methods. In addition to their remarkable speed, these systems are recognized for being environmentally friendly, with the potential to dramatically decrease carbon emissions and pollution, addressing critical global concerns. Consequently, the advantages of the Hyperloop have garnered substantial investments from both private entities and public organizations worldwide, fueling the expansion of the autonomous network market.

Restraints in the Global Autonomous Networks Hyperloop Market

The Global Autonomous Networks Hyperloop market faces several challenges that may hinder its growth. Significant investments are needed for constructing vacuum-sealed tubes, magnetic levitation tracks, and specialized vehicles, creating a formidable barrier to entry for manufacturers, particularly for startups and smaller firms. Additionally, various technical challenges arise in managing air pressure, addressing temperature fluctuations, and ensuring safety and reliability at high speeds. These complexities not only add to the overall costs but can also slow down development and implementation efforts, ultimately affecting the market's expansion and the ability of new players to compete effectively.

Market Trends of the Global Autonomous Networks Hyperloop Market

The Global Autonomous Networks Hyperloop market is witnessing a significant trend towards sustainability, driven by rising concerns over environmental impact and climate change. As traditional transportation methods face scrutiny, manufacturers are increasingly investing in Hyperloop technology as a cleaner, faster alternative. This has fostered collaborative efforts between Hyperloop companies and various organizations to innovate and enhance their systems. Enhanced focus on efficiency, reduced carbon footprints, and integration with renewable energy sources is shaping the industry's trajectory. As stakeholders prioritize eco-friendly solutions, the Hyperloop market is poised for substantial growth, capitalizing on the demand for advanced, sustainable transportation options worldwide.
